What Causes High Humidity in Basements?

Basements are humidity magnets—and it’s not just bad luck. Several factors contribute to the damp environment:

– **Groundwater seepage:** Water from rain or snow can seep through foundation walls or floors, especially if your home has cracks or poor drainage.
– **Condensation:** Cool basement surfaces (like concrete walls or pipes) can cause warm, moist air to condense into water droplets—similar to how a cold drink sweats on a hot day.
– **Poor ventilation:** Unlike upstairs rooms, basements often lack windows or proper airflow, trapping moist air inside.
– **Plumbing leaks:** Even small leaks from pipes or water heaters can add significant moisture over time.
– **High outdoor humidity:** In humid climates, moisture can enter through cracks or open windows, raising indoor humidity levels.

All these factors combine to create a consistently damp environment. And once humidity climbs above 60%, you’re in the danger zone for mold and mildew growth.

The Science of Humidity and Mold Growth

Mold doesn’t need standing water to grow—it just needs moisture in the air. Most molds begin to develop when relative humidity stays above 60% for extended periods. In a basement, this can happen quickly, especially during summer months when warm, humid air meets cool basement surfaces.

Once mold spores take hold, they spread fast. They release mycotoxins and spores into the air, which can trigger allergies, asthma attacks, and other respiratory issues. And because basements are often enclosed, these pollutants can circulate into the rest of your home through HVAC systems.

But it’s not just mold. Dust mites—tiny creatures that feed on dead skin cells—also thrive in humid environments. They’re a common allergen and can worsen symptoms for people with allergies or asthma. By keeping humidity below 50%, you create an environment where these pests can’t survive.

Protecting Your Home and Belongings

Preventing Structural Damage

Your home is one of your biggest investments—and moisture is one of its worst enemies. Over time, excess humidity can cause serious damage to your basement and foundation.

Wooden support beams, floor joists, and framing can absorb moisture and begin to rot. This weakens the structural integrity of your home and can lead to costly repairs. Metal components like nails, screws, and HVAC ducts can rust, reducing their lifespan and efficiency.

Even concrete isn’t immune. Prolonged exposure to moisture can cause efflorescence (white, powdery deposits), spalling (surface flaking), and cracks that allow more water to enter. A dehumidifier helps keep the air dry, reducing the risk of these issues and extending the life of your home’s foundation.

Safeguarding Stored Items

Basements are often used for storage—clothes, books, photos, electronics, and sentimental items. But these belongings are at high risk in a damp environment.

Clothes can develop mildew, giving them a sour smell and ruining fabrics. Books and paper documents can warp, yellow, or grow mold. Electronics are especially vulnerable; moisture can corrode internal components and cause permanent damage.

Reducing Pest Infestations

Damp basements attract more than just mold. Insects like silverfish, centipedes, and even termites are drawn to moist environments. These pests don’t just creep people out—they can cause real damage.

Silverfish eat paper and glue, damaging books and wallpaper. Termites feed on wood and can compromise your home’s structure. Even common house spiders prefer humid, dark spaces.

A dry basement is far less appealing to pests. By using a dehumidifier, you create an environment that’s unwelcoming to unwanted visitors, reducing the need for pesticides and pest control services.

Energy Efficiency and Cost Savings

How Dehumidifiers Reduce Cooling Costs

You might not think of a dehumidifier as an energy-saving device—but it can be. Here’s why: humid air feels warmer than dry air at the same temperature. This is because moisture in the air slows down the evaporation of sweat from your skin, making you feel sticky and uncomfortable.

In summer, if your basement is humid, your body will feel hotter, prompting you to turn up the air conditioner. But a dehumidifier removes moisture from the air, making it feel cooler and more comfortable. This means you can set your thermostat a few degrees higher without sacrificing comfort—leading to lower energy bills.

Some modern dehumidifiers are also ENERGY STAR certified, meaning they use less electricity than standard models. Over time, the savings on your utility bill can offset the cost of the unit.

Choosing the Right Dehumidifier for Your Basement

Key Features to Look For

Not all dehumidifiers are created equal—especially when it comes to basement use. Here’s what to consider:

– **Capacity:** Measured in pints per day, this tells you how much moisture the unit can remove. For a typical basement (up to 1,500 sq. ft.), a 30–50 pint model is usually sufficient. Larger or damper basements may need 70+ pint units.
– **Energy Efficiency:** Look for ENERGY STAR certification to save on electricity.
– **Automatic Shut-Off:** Prevents overflow when the water tank is full.
– **Continuous Drainage:** Allows you to attach a hose so water drains directly into a floor drain or sump pump—no need to empty the tank.
– **Built-in Hygrometer:** Monitors humidity levels and adjusts operation automatically.
– **Low Temperature Operation:** Some basements get cold in winter. Choose a model that works efficiently down to 41°F (5°C) or lower.
– **Quiet Operation:** Basements are often near living spaces. A quiet unit (under 50 decibels) won’t disturb your peace.

Placement and Maintenance Tips

Where you place your dehumidifier matters. For best results:

– Position it in the center of the basement or near the source of moisture (like a laundry area or sump pump).
– Keep it at least 6–12 inches away from walls and furniture for proper airflow.
– Avoid placing it near heat sources or in direct sunlight.

Maintenance is simple but important:

– Empty the water tank regularly (unless using continuous drainage).
– Clean the air filter every 2–4 weeks to ensure efficient airflow.
– Wipe down the exterior and check for dust buildup.
– Inspect the coils and drain hose annually.

With proper care, a quality dehumidifier can last 5–10 years or more.

Frequently Asked Questions

Do I really need a dehumidifier in my basement?

Yes, if your basement feels damp, smells musty, or shows signs of mold or condensation. Even if you don’t see obvious water, high humidity can still cause damage and health issues over time.

What humidity level should I maintain in my basement?

Aim for 30% to 50% relative humidity. This range prevents mold growth, dust mites, and structural damage while keeping the air comfortable.

Can a dehumidifier help with basement odors?

Absolutely. Musty smells are often caused by mold and mildew, which thrive in humid environments. Removing excess moisture eliminates the source of the odor.

Will a dehumidifier increase my electricity bill?

It may add a small amount to your bill, but ENERGY STAR models are efficient. Plus, by making your home feel cooler, it can reduce AC usage and save money overall.

How often should I empty the dehumidifier tank?

It depends on the humidity level and tank size. Most units need emptying every 1–3 days. Using a continuous drain hose eliminates this chore.

Can I use a regular room dehumidifier in my basement?

Not recommended. Basement dehumidifiers are built to handle colder temperatures and higher moisture levels. Regular units may not work efficiently or could freeze up.
